Houston man wins $52,000 playing lottery

Published: October 19, 2012 

A Houston County man won $1,000 a week for a year -- $52,000 -- playing the Georgia Lottery, according to a news release.

Steven Baughman of Kathleen won the prize by matching the first five winning numbers plus the free ball in the Oct. 3 Win For Life drawing.

Houston Lake Food Store, 1946 South Houston Lake Road, sold the winning ticket.

Baughman, 54, a tools and parts attendant, said in a news release that he found out the next day when he checked the results on the lottery’s website.

He and his wife, Amelia, plan to pay off bills and have a car repaired with the money, the release states.
